Design Pressure Analysis: The Backbone of Effective Shutters

Design pressure refers to the calculated force that wind and other weather elements exert on a structure. For hurricane shutters, this analysis is pivotal in determining their ability to protect your home without succumbing to the pressure. It considers various factors, including the dimensions and location of windows and doors, as well as the building’s overall design and orientation.

Without a thorough design pressure analysis, shutters might fail when faced with the intense winds of a hurricane, rendering them ineffective. This analysis ensures that each shutter is tailored to withstand the specific challenges posed by the unique conditions of your home in Carolina Shores.

Understanding Design Pressures in Detail

Grasping the concept of design pressures is crucial for homeowners in Carolina Shores. It’s the foundation upon which the safety and integrity of hurricane shutters rest.

Negative vs. Positive Design Pressures

Negative design pressure occurs when wind forcefully hits one side of a structure, creating a suction effect on the opposite side. This phenomenon can lead to windows and doors being pulled outward, compromising the home’s integrity. Positive design pressure, on the other hand, pushes against the structure, which can cause buckling or inward collapse if not properly mitigated.

Understanding these pressures is essential for selecting shutters that can effectively counteract both forces, ensuring your home remains secure and intact even under the harshest conditions.

The Role of Wind Loads and Building Orientation

The direction and speed of hurricane winds can significantly influence the amount of pressure exerted on a home. Additionally, the orientation of the building plays a critical role in how these winds impact the structure. A comprehensive design pressure analysis takes these factors into account, tailoring the shutters to offer optimal protection based on the specific challenges your home faces.

This meticulous approach ensures that no matter the direction from which the storm approaches, your shutters will be ready to withstand the onslaught, safeguarding your home and loved ones.

Customizing Shutters for Your Carolina Shores Home

The process of customizing hurricane shutters is both an art and a science. It requires a deep understanding of the forces at play and a commitment to protecting your home.

Initial Assessment and Computer Modeling

The first step involves a detailed inspection of your property, focusing on potential vulnerabilities. Advanced computer modeling is then used to simulate the specific wind loads your shutters must resist. This data forms the basis for designing shutters that are not just robust but are precisely engineered for your home’s unique requirements.

This process ensures that each shutter is not only strong enough to withstand hurricane forces but also fits perfectly, enhancing the overall protection of your home.

Customization and Installation

Following the assessment and modeling, the shutters are customized to match the exact specifications of your windows and doors. This includes selecting the right materials, determining the appropriate fastening methods, and ensuring that the shutters blend seamlessly with your home’s architecture.

The final step is the professional installation of these shutters, securing your home’s defenses against the unpredictable fury of hurricanes. Enhancing Hurricane Preparedness Beyond Shutters

While hurricane shutters are a vital component of your home’s defense against severe weather, it’s important to adopt a comprehensive approach to hurricane preparedness. This includes creating a family emergency plan, securing loose outdoor items, reinforcing garage doors, and having a sufficient supply of emergency provisions.

Family Emergency Plan

Developing a detailed family emergency plan ensures that everyone in your household knows what to do in the event of a hurricane. This plan should include evacuation routes, designated meeting points, contact information for emergency services, and a checklist of essential items to pack.

Regularly reviewing and practicing your family emergency plan can help ensure that everyone is well-prepared and can act swiftly and decisively when faced with an approaching storm.

Securing Outdoor Items

Loose outdoor items, such as patio furniture, garden tools, and decorations, can become hazardous projectiles during a hurricane. Securing or storing these items before a storm hits can prevent them from causing damage to your home or posing a danger to your family and neighbors.

Consider investing in sturdy storage solutions or anchors to keep outdoor items safely in place during high winds. Additionally, trimming trees and shrubs around your property can reduce the risk of branches breaking off and causing damage during a storm.

Reinforcing Garage Doors

Garage doors are often vulnerable points in a home’s defense against hurricanes. High winds can exert significant pressure on garage doors, leading to structural failure and potential breaches that can compromise the entire house.

Reinforcing your garage doors with bracing kits or impact-resistant materials can help fortify this weak spot and minimize the risk of structural damage during a hurricane. Regular maintenance and inspections of garage door mechanisms are also essential to ensure they are functioning correctly and can withstand the forces of a storm.
